Is Nikaia Safe for Solo Female Travelers?

Nikaia generally boasts a safe environment. As a solo female traveler, it is still crucial to take the usual precautions as with travelling anywhere else - avoid secluded areas especially at night and always be aware of your surroundings. The locals are amicable and helpful, and violent crimes are relatively low. Nevertheless, petty theft such as pickpocketing can occur in crowded tourist spots, so maintaining vigilance with personal items is important.

How safe is Nikaia?

Safety at night:

Safety at night:Moderate

Nikaia is generally considered a safe part of Greece. However, like with any city, there are neighborhoods that could require more caution, especially at late hours. Always pay attention to your surroundings, try to stay within well-lit and populated areas, and avoid appearing overly touristy. Using a reliable means of transportation at night, rather than walking alone, can help ensure your safety.
Public transportation:

Public transportation:Safe

Overall, public transportation in Nikaia is generally safe for solo female travelers. There's a wide range of reliable transportation means available including buses, taxis, and trains which are well-maintained and operate according to schedules. However, like any urban area, always stay cautious of pickpocketing and avoid traveling alone late at night.
Street harassment:

Street harassment:Low

In Nikaia, there is generally a very low level of street harassment. The locals are known to be respectful and friendly towards foreigners, and there is a strong police presence which ensures public safety. However, like anywhere, you might come across some unwelcome attention. Remember to trust your instincts, keep your belongings close, and act confidently. It's not a widespread problem, but it's always essential to remain vigilant.
Petty crimes:

Petty crimes:Low

Nikaia, like most areas in Greece, is generally safe in terms of petty crimes such as pickpocketing and theft. It is advisable, however, to always be aware of your surroundings, especially in crowded areas, and make sure to secure your valuables at all times. While the likelihood of encountering such issues is relatively low, it's always better to use caution and employ common sense guidelines to further minimize any risk.
